What’s OUTintheOPEN?
OUTintheOPEN Festival (LGBTI health/well-being forum + Carnival Day + More)
OUTintheOPEN Festival Shepparton
OUTintheOPEN is Shepparton’s newest festival celebrating community diversity.
OUTintheOPEN was developed to address some of the inequalities faced by the local gay, lesbian, bisexual, transgender, intersex, queer (GLBTIQ) & allied communities and to build a more inclusive community in Greater Shepparton.
OUTintheOPEN is a project led by Goulburn Valley Pride Inc. and is proudly supported by many other organisations and community groups, including:
• The Bridge Youth Service
• Kildonan UnitingCare
• PFLAG (Parents, Family members & Friends of Lesbian & Gay people) Greater Shepparton
• Diversity Group (same-sex attracted & sex/gender diverse young person’s social-support group)
• Goulburn Valley Health
• Centre for Excellence in Rural Sexual Health (CERSH)
• Relationships Australia Victoria
• Goulburn Valley Primary Care Partnership
• Greater Shepparton City Council
• Goulburn North East Women’s Health
• Goulburn Valley Hotel
• Victoria Police
The festival will consist of a health/well-being forum at Goulburn Valley Hotel function rooms and a Carnival day in November at the Queens Gardens. Other events will occur during the weekend across the City of Greater Shepparton.
